Capitalising on Qatar link ‘my last big wish' says Williams
Reaping the fruits of the collaboration with Qatar is Sir Frank Wiliams' 'last big wish', he admitted on Tuesday.
A couple of years ago, the British team partnered with the soverign Arab state to establish the Williams Technology Centre in Qatar, to develop and commercialise F1-bred technologies.
Williams, 71, is still the Grove based team's boss, but he has handed over many of his responsibilities to his new deputy Claire, his daughter.
But Frank Williams told Germany's Auto Motor und Sport that he still deals primarily with the political side of F1, and liaising with the likes of the FIA and Bernie Ecclestone.
